4. FIRST AID MEASURES
Inhalation: No acute effects expected. If symptoms or irritation occur with any exposure, call a
physician.

Skin contact: Wash with soap and large amounts of water. Remove contaminated clothing. If
symptoms or irritation occur, call a physician.

If product is accidentally injected into or under the skin, regardless of wound size or
initial absence of symptoms, the individual should be evaluated immediately by a
physician as a surgical emergency.

Ingestion: Not expected to be acutely toxic. If large amounts are swallowed, immediately call a
physician.

Eye contact: Flush eyes with large amounts of tepid water for at least 15 minutes. If symptoms or
irritation occur, call a physician.




MSDS ID NO.: 0183MAR019 Product name: Marathon Super Maraplex EP-2 Page 2 of 8
Notes to physician: High velocity injection under the skin may result in serious injury. If left untreated the
affected area is subject to infection, disfigurement, lack of blood circulation and may
require amputation. When dispensed by high pressure equipment this material can
easily penetrate the skin and leave a bloodless puncture wound. Material injected
into a finger can be deposited into the palm of the hand. Within 24-48 hours the
patient may experience swelling, discoloration, and throbbing pain in the affected
area. Immediate treatment by a surgical specialist is recommended.

5. F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ES
Suitable extinguishing media: For small fires, Class B fire extinguishing media such as
CO2, dry chemical, foam (AFFF/ATC) or water spray can be
used. For large fires, water spray, fog or foam (AFFT/ATC)
can be used. Fire fighting should be attempted only by those
who are adequately trained and equipped with proper
protective equipment.
Specific hazards: The product is not combustlble per the OSHA Hazard
Communication Standard, but will ignite and burn at
temperatures exceeding the flash point.
Special protective equipment for firefighters: Avoid using straight water streams. Water spray and foam
(AFFF/ATC) must be applied carefully to avoid frothing and
from as far a distance as possible. Avoid excessive water
spray application. Use water spray to cool exposed surfaces
from as far a distance as possible. Keep run-off water out of
sewers and water sources.

7. HANDLING AND STORAGE
Handling:




MSDS ID NO.: 0183MAR019 Product name: Marathon Super Maraplex EP-2 Page 3 of 8
Comply with all applicable EPA, OSHA, NFPA and consistent state and local requirements. Use appropriate grounding
and bonding practices. All five gallon pails and larger metal containers (including tank cars and tank trucks) should be
grounded and/or bonded when material is transferred. Store in properly closed containers that are appropriately labeled
and in a cool well-ventilated area. Do not cut, drill, grind or weld on empty containers since they may contain explosive
residues. Do not expose to heat, open flames, strong oxidizers or other sources of ignition.

Avoid repeated and prolonged skin contact. Exercise good personal hygiene including removal of soiled clothing and
prompt washing with soap and water.

8. EXPOSURE CONTROLS / PERSONAL PROTECTION
PERSONAL PROTECTIVE EQUIPMENT

Engineering measures: Local or general exhaust required when using at elevated temperatures that
generate vapors or mists.

Respiratory protection: Not required under normal conditions and adequate ventilation. Approved organic
vapor chemical cartridge or supplied air respirators should be worn when significant
vapors are generated. Observe respirator protection factor criteria cited in ANSI
Z88.2. Self-contained breathing apparatus should be used for fire fighting.

Skin and body protection: Use chemical resistant gloves such as neoprene, nitrile, or PVA to prevent prolonged
or repeated skin contact.

Eye protection: Not normally required for routine operations.

13. DISPOSAL CONSIDERATIONS
Cleanup Considerations: Don't pollute, conserve resources. "Empty" drums and drum
liners retain residue (solid, liquid and/or vapor) that will burn
and can be dangerous. Do not attempt to clean and reuse.
Dispose of empty drum liners in an environmentally safe
manner. "Empty" drums should be completely drained,
properly bunged and promptly returned to a drum
reconditioner. This material as supplied and by itself,
when discarded or disposed of, is not an EPA RCRA
hazardous waste according to federal regulations.
This material could become a hazardous waste if mixed or
contaminated with a hazardous waste or other substance(s).
It is the responsibility of the user to determine if disposal
material is hazardous according to federal, state and local
regulations.
